Creates drawings using a variety of tools including Revit and AutoCAD. Generally, building plans and sections will be created through 3-dimensional modeling with Revit. Single line diagrams and similar drawings will be created using AutoCAD.
Responsibilities:
- Develops, modifies and reviews Revit models of mechanical systems and components including ductwork and piping systems according to established standards and Revit modeling techniques, based on input from the engineering team. Creates project drawings from the Revit model.
- Develops, modifies and reviews Revit models of electrical engineering systems and components according to established standards and Revit modeling techniques, based on input from the electrical engineering team. Creates project drawings from the Revit model.
- Develops, modifies and reviews Revit models of plumbing systems and components according to established standards and Revit modeling techniques, based on input from the engineering team. Creates project drawings from the Revit model.
- Develops flow diagrams, riser diagrams, control diagrams and similar project documents using AutoCAD.
- Organizes and maintains Revit models and AutoCAD documents for multiple projects.
- Works closely with project team and assists to complete projects on aggressive schedules.
- Performs all work in a clear, complete, and accurate manner.
- Uses Revit to check the design for interferences with other building elements.
- Utilizes knowledge and experience in applying modeling principles for drawings.
- Produces equipment schedules, making changes and adjustments as necessary with input from the engineering team as required.
- Utilizes knowledge and experience in applying drafting principles for drawings.
